Find the distance between (-9,-5) and (4,-3)

The distance between the points (-9, -5) and (4, -3) is 13.153 units approximately

Solution:

Given, two points are (-9, -5) and (4, -3).

We need to find the distance between above two points.

We know that, distance between two points
P\left(x_(1), y_(1)\right) \text { and } Q\left(x_(2), y_(2)\right) is given by:


d(P, Q)=\sqrt{\left(x_(2)-x_(1)\right)^(2)+\left(y_(2)-y_(1)\right)^(2)}


\text { here, } x_(1)=-9, y_(1)=-5, x_(2)=4 \text { and } y_(2)=-3


\begin{array}{l}{\text { distance }=\sqrt{(4-(-9))^(2)+(-3-(-5))^(2)}=\sqrt{(4+9)^(2)+(5-3)^(2)}} \\\\ {=\sqrt{(13)^(2)+(2)^(2)}=√(169+4)=√(173)=13.152946}\end{array}

Hence the distance between points is 13.153 units approximately
